ApplauseIT are hiring for an Application Analyst to join a growing company within the Local Government Software sector. This role is ideal for a tech-savvy problem solver with a passion for application support, troubleshooting, and customer service in a Windows-based environment.
The Role
- Support client-server and web applications in a Windows Server environment.
- Manage incidents, troubleshoot issues, and ensure timely resolutions for customers.
- Collaborate with project and delivery teams to onboard new customers.
- Work closely with the service desk to maintain hosted applications.
- Develop innovative solutions to improve service efficiency.
- Ensure security compliance and adhere to company policies.
- Stay up to date with new technologies and industry trends.
What You’ll Need
- 3+ years’ experience in application support (client-server and web-based systems, e.g. Apache, IIS).
- Strong SQL database skills (Microsoft SQL Server, Oracle).
- Knowledge of Windows Server and application deployment.
- Scripting experience (SQL, PowerShell, Python, VBS).
- Understanding of networking (TCP/IP, DNS, Firewalls).
- Awareness of cybersecurity best practices.
- Experience with monitoring tools (e.g. PRTG, Zabbix) is desirable.
- ITIL experience in incident, problem, and change management.
- Local government software experience is a plus but not essential.
